I am considering this to aid maintenance on a large-scale project.


Just wondering if anybody has actually used any functionality that allows you to predefine all of the hyperlinks with variables - so that if a student clicks on a hyperlink or any other form of link, rather than hardcoding the server address of the document or web page, it uses a variable with that location??


Any thoughts or ideas, or is this potentially new functionality in Lectora 11?

Possible, yes. But you'll have to replace true hyperlinks with quasi hyperlinks that use JavaScript. Then you can get the url from the variable and go to that url.
